Transaction 39c73950979cbdcf91dba607a2bf520367097bd1adc17deeb3a7967b45e8b37f
1 Input
1 Output
-
39c73950979cbdcf91dba607a2bf520367097bd1adc17deeb3a7967b45e8b37f:0
- value
- 270047502
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74f83d1c13d522465695451e463427364456e0e8 OP_EQUAL
- address
- MJZdzcMn9FcpL4eTFyn613wCpL1MFdGw2s